Basketball Preview: Rodriguez Mustangs vs. Wood Wildcats
The Rodriguez Mustangs will venture away from home to challenge the Wood Wildcats at 7:30 p.m. on Friday. The teams are on pretty different trajectories at the moment (Rodriguez has three straight wins, Wood has four straight losses), but none of that matters once you're on the court.
On Wednesday, Rodriguez strolled past Vacaville with points to spare, taking the game 71-52. Given the Mustangs' advantage in MaxPreps' California basketball rankings (they are ranked 210th, while the Bulldogs are ranked 893rd),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.
Wood played against Vanden and lost via forfeit.
Rodriguez is on a roll lately: they've won 11 of their last 13 matches, which provided a nice bump to their 19-5 record this season. Those victories came thanks to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 79.1 points per game. As for Wood, they now have a losing record at 12-13.
Rodriguez took their victory against Wood in their previous meeting back in January by a conclusive 79-59. The rematch might be a little tougher for Rodriguez since the squad won't have the home-court adv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
